Output 1cecf63c1711a81ef39a374d14e1b5649e41761c4f4b08ac315facd976f54495:72

value
104654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e104e4f2db385957d6995970ec680f7dad66a0 OP_EQUAL
address
37svkztLiPwzfomTHtwCYUZbVNQ6PSLCa9
transaction
1cecf63c1711a81ef39a374d14e1b5649e41761c4f4b08ac315facd976f54495
spent
true